La Traviata is probably one of Verdi’s most popular works and perhaps one of the world's favourite operas. First, there is the libretto, which is delightfully melodramatic. Secondly, the music is simple and effective, admirably designed in its effects and theatrical in the most positive sense of the word. Finally, there are its themes, which were very popular in the 19th century, redemption through true love and fate, linked in this case to the image of a courtesan, a woman gone astray – a theme that introduces an eminently modern and romantic note to the drama. Violetta is a heroin straight out of a novel. What is moving about La Traviata is this focus on a single character, who carries the weight of the world on her shoulders, the raw power of her singing, her obsessive presence, her death for the sake of love and her agony written in the music.
